Do not fret over the creation of your letters to Santa or business website. Coding HTML, find graphics, learn to develop a shopping cart online – for many people, these tasks alone are a huge problem, but they need not be. We give you easy forward and useful advice on how you can have a professional letters to Father Christmas or business website.

Step One – Register a domain name

The first step is to register a domain name. A great place to register your domain name cheap GoDaddy.com. Keep in mind that you do not need to purchase website host with GoDaddy, but you can simply save a domain name with them. You will also need to make a list of names of potential areas in advance, because you quickly discover that the name you May your heart to be taken. You may also include some way the words Santa, letters, personalized Christmas and your domain name, or you can Simply use your business name as your domain name.

Step Two – Buy Website Hosting

Website hosting companies are thirteen to the dozen, so you'll want to do your homework before you commit to any long-term. Make some comparison shopping and see what each site of the host society has to offer, and be wary of super cheap website hosting. You want to examine, firstly, why their web hosting is so cheap. If you can, purchase website hosting on a monthly basis. So if you have any problems with a business, you can simply cancel and receive a better accommodation elsewhere. Webmaster beginners we suggest CPanel hosting site Fanastico with Deluxe. Fantastico is a single / CPanel PHP based Web application that makes it easy to install applications such as

  • Blogs
  • Customer support desk
  • E-commerce shopping carts
  • Mailing Lists
  • Discussion forums
  • Galleries Image
  • and more!

Step Three – Website Design

Since it is very likely you are a novice webmaster, it is unwise to design and create your website from scratch. It is better, or hire someone to create a model Web site, hire a web designer, or buying a premade website template.

If you go the route Web Designer

If you go the route web designer, you can someone Scout Web site of freelance "as eLance.com or Guru.com, or check out designer names and contact info at the bottom of sites you like. Be sure to be as descriptive as possible when tells the designer of the site you have in mind. If you can, take screen shots of websites with the look you want in your site, or simply links e-mail sites that you want the designer. And do not be afraid to say what you dislike. The more descriptive you are, the better the results of your site design. You should also ask the web designer to install a shopping cart for an appropriate letters to Santa online business. You may need to hire a web programmer for this task.

If you go website Road model

If you want to use a website template, you can browse the Internet and look for the site Santa premade designs, or you can hire someone to modify or create a new website template for you. Just keep in mind that to maintain your site, you will need to work in WYSIWYG (What You See Is What You Get) web editor to make changes or modify your template. You can use an editor HTML such as Microsoft FrontPage or Adobe Dreamweaver to publish your website. If you choose not to use a WYSIWYG web editor, you might be embarrassed if you try changing your model because you'll see a lot of html code.

Step Four – Payment Processing

To start accepting payments online, you will need a payment processor online. If you wish, you can use a third party payment processor by such as PayPal or 2Checkout. With them, you do not necessarily need a business bank account. You'll want to do some research on this subject and to decide which option is best for your home business.

Once your site is fully developed, test your shopping cart, Web forms and other features to ensure your site is configured to take orders online. Once you have everything working, you will need to start promoting your online store of letters to Santa through online advertising and perhaps hire someone to do the optimization search engine for your site. You'll want to make a list of what must be done to get your letters to Santa website launched. Take a sheet of paper and write step by step what should be done first and then start checking the list as you complete each task.

Many bloggers use WordPress and rightly so. This is the software's most popular blogs in use today and one of the main reasons is the ability to add features through the use of plugins. Plugins can turn your run-of-the-mill blog in a tool for high voltage Online can bring traffic and profit from your site. Consider using WordPress plugins for your current main WordPress blog or a blog future. You will not be disappointed. Happy blogging.

7. Page Mash

This is a simple management of WordPress plugin page. The Ajax interface allows you drag and drop the pages in any order you wish, change the page structure by dragging a page to become a child or a parent page and switch must be hidden. You can also see the id of the page that is often useful for theme developers. If you have a WordPress site with more than just a handful of pages, PageMash is extremely useful.

6. All in One SEO Pack

The All in One SEO Pack plugin automatically optimizes your WordPress blog for search engine allowing you to fine-tune things like your page title and meta tags. This plugin is extremely easy to use because it works very well straight out of the box. If you are an advanced user, you can customize almost everything. And if you're a developer, this plugin has an API to that your themes can access and extend the functionality of the plugin.

5. Google XML Sitemaps

Perhaps the most WordPress plugin downloaded the plugin Google XML Sitemaps, not only automatically creates a site map link to all your pages and posts, it also notifies Google Bing, Yahoo, Ask.com and when you make changes to your site. If you want to include pages that are part of your site, but is not part of your WordPress content managed, you can do that.

4. WP Super Cache

If you have a WordPress site popular you should seriously consider running WordPress Super cache to improve performance of your website. If you are not caching your pages, then each time a visitor accesses your site WordPress has to gather various information on a database to put your page together. If you have a site with heavy traffic, this may really be a problem. WP Super Cache stores a copy of each page of your website so that when the page was assembled from database once, WordPress can relax and just continue to serve static HTML copy of the page. This could be a bit techie, but the idea that you can greatly speed up your site and reduce the load on your server using WP Super Cache. If for no other reason, use this plugin, you So do not panic when your friend says: "I just Dugg your site. "

3. NextGen Photo Gallery

If you want to display a photo gallery, show a series of product images, or simply post a slideshow of your most recent vacation, the image gallery is NextGen the plugin for you. NextGen Gallery is a full integrated Image Gallery plugin for WordPress with a Flash slideshow option. Among many features, NextGen Gallery includes a thumbnail generator, albums sortable, function and brand of water.

2. cformsII Form Plugin

If you are looking for a plugin Free form management, cformsII is an extremely powerful plugin for creating contact forms on your WordPress site. You do not need to know or write any PHP code. You can visually build forms in the WordPress admin panel. Then go to the page or position where you want to use the form and there is a button in the WYSIWYG editor that you click and up pops a list of forms that you did. Simply click on whatever you want and your form is inserted in your page. Update your page and the form is live. You can specify required fields, default values, and there are many styles to fit your mix perfectly with your site.

1. Gravity Forms

If you want the best forms plugin WordPress has to offer, you need Gravity Forms. Gravity Forms is a plug surprise to the management of online forms. Some incredibly useful devices include conditional formatting of fields which means you can show or hide a field or whole sections of the form based on value selected in another field. You can pre-populate form fields using QueryString, shortcode, function or hooks.You can even schedule when forms are available by assigning a start date and end when your form is online on your site. Suppose you want to start a contest where the first 50 people who filled out the form win a prize. Severities lets you set a limit on the number of entries of a form can receive. Pretty much everything you've always wanted to make a form, severities can.
